Keycloak Rest Api Documentation, authenticators org.

Keycloak Rest Api Documentation, Use the collection and 🔐 Secure API Authentication with Keycloak & Data API Builder (DAB) This repository contains a complete, Dockerized example demonstrating how to build a secure API using Keycloak as an Identity Provider Abstract Javadocs for Red Hat build of Keycloak 22. 6. You can invoke this REST API from your Java applications by obtaining an access token. A new preview version 2 for the Identity Brokering APIs is introduced in this release. Built for B2B SaaS on Keycloak. broker Depending on your requirements, a resource server should be able to manage resources remotely or even check for permissions programmatically. authentication. For more information about Keycloak visit the Keycloak homepage and Keycloak blog. Covers JWT validation, DRF permissions, and custom backends. Red Hat build of Keycloak API Documentation 1. Comprehensive guide to the Keycloak Admin REST API with Cloud-IAM. Publish straight from GitHub or Bitbucket. This enterprise-ready library provides a By integrating this method into your RESTful API ecosystem, you can ensure that only authorized users have access to your resources and protect sensitive data. To invoke the API you need to obtain an access By looking at the code in github docs for Node. 0 (the "License"); you may not use this file except in compliance with the Open Source Identity and Access Management For Modern Applications and Services - keycloak/keycloak Keycloak API Quick Reference: Comprehensive, developer-friendly documentation that covers all CRUD of a user lifecycle. To invoke the API you need to obtain an access token with the appropriate Comprehensive guide to the Keycloak Admin REST API with Cloud-IAM. To invoke the API you need to obtain an access これは Keycloak 管理 REST API の REST API リファレンスです。 Learn how to manage users, roles, and realms in Keycloak using its powerful Admin REST API with real-world Java examples. Keycloak has packed some functionality in features, including some disabled features, such as Technology Preview and Admin REST API To invoke the API you need to obtain an access token with the appropriate permissions. In this article, we will Enabling and disabling features Configure Keycloak to use optional features. version: "1. 0. 0 | Red Hat Documentation Licensed under the Apache License, Version 2. AI interactive demos Explore scenarios with Red Hat Secure your Spring Boot REST API using Keycloak’s Client Credentials Grant with OAuth2 Resource Server. Red Hat build of Keycloak API Documentation Legal Notice Format Chapter 2. It validates Keycloak-issued OIDC access tokens, owns the local user table, enforces one hidden NVIDIA Infra Controller - Hardware Lifecycle Management and multitenant networking - NVIDIA/infra-controller From c34027f6b0a332cc9fa0cea9e5daf23d5360cd6c Mon Sep 17 00:00:00 2001 From: Qyperion Date: Thu, 30 Oct 2025 15:50:28 +0200 Subject: [PATCH] Update to Keycloak 26. Adoption rates depend on orchestration quality (device Keycloak API Quick Reference: Comprehensive, developer-friendly documentation that covers all CRUD of a user lifecycle. In this guide, we’ll walk through how to update user custom attributes using the Keycloak Admin REST API, including endpoint details, Learn how to add or update users with roles in Keycloak programmatically through REST API or Admin Client. Locale can only be set via GUI: Desired situation: locale should be modifiable via Admin REST API. 2 Open Source Identity and Access Management For Modern Applications and Services - keycloak/keycloak Open source Keycloak extension that adds first-class organizations: per-tenant SSO, invitations, roles, and APIs. Therefore, the locale of a user can't be set via the Admin REST API. CMS REST API Overview This page focuses on the CMS REST APIs exposed by the Entando App Engine and on the Postman assets provided above for testing them. 0 | Red Hat Documentation 管理者 REST API を使用して、ユーザーストレージプロバイダーのデプロイメント Keycloakには、管理コンソールが提供するすべての機能を完全に備えた管理REST APIが付属しています。 APIを呼び出すには、適切な権限を持つアクセストー Keycloak Documentation Open Source Identity and Access Management for modern Applications and Services. 0" tags: - name: Attack Detection - name: Authentication Management - name: Authenticating with a service account To authenticate against the Admin REST API using a client_id and a client_secret, perform this procedure. Admin REST API Red Hat build of Keycloak comes with a fully functional Admin REST API with all features provided by the Admin Console. The User Storage SPI is built on top of a generic Red Hat build of Keycloak is based on a set of administrative UIs and a RESTful API, and provides the necessary means to create permissions for your protected You may wish to programmatically manage aspects of your Keycloak setup via the Keycloak API. WorkOS Directory Sync exposes an application as a SCIM target, FitFlow ApiGateway FitFlow ApiGateway is the REST boundary for the FitFlow interview flow. To invoke the API you need to obtain an access Keycloak REST Admin API Demonstration This project demonstrates how a third-party application can communicate and manage Keycloak resources via API. We have a simple Spring Boot Web App (API REST) into a Kubernetes JavaDocs Documentation JavaDocs Documentation Admin REST API Documentation Administration REST API Do Keycloak and FusionAuth both support passkeys? Both Keycloak and FusionAuth support WebAuthn passkeys natively per public documentation. Admin REST API | Server Developer Guide | Red Hat build of Keycloak | 26. 0 (the "License"); you may not use this file except in compliance with the Overview This is a REST API reference for the Keycloak Admin REST API. I need some tips in order to understand how to perform a client authentication with x509 certificate against Keycloak. Table of Contents Table of Contents MAKING OPEN SOURCE MORE INCLUSIVE Keycloak Documentation Open Source Identity and Access Management for modern Applications and Services. To invoke 第2章 管理 REST API Red Hat build of Keycloak には、管理コンソールの全機能が含まれる、完全に機能する管理 REST API が同梱されています。 API を呼び出すには、適切な権限を持つアクセス Learn how to validate Keycloak tokens for API security using local JWT verification, token introspection, and framework integrations. 0 | Red Hat Documentation Github Youtube Twitter Developer resources Cloud learning hub Interactive labs Training and certification Customer support API Documentation | Red Hat build of Keycloak | 24. To invoke the API you need to obtain an access token with 🚀 A powerful and feature-rich . JS client library and Keycloak admin REST api documentation you can find how to perform actions and what are the required values for that. When brokering is used during the authentication process, Keycloak allows you to store tokens and The architectural difference is worth stating clearly: Keycloak's SCIM API exposes a Keycloak realm as a SCIM target. 0 upwards To use the Keycloak Admin REST API, you need an access token from a user with the proper permissions. Welcome to the Keycloak CRUD API Quick Reference! This project serves as a concise reference guide for performing Create, Read, Update, and Delete (CRUD) operations using the Keycloak API. info: title: Keycloak Admin REST API description: This is a REST API reference for the Keycloak Admin REST API. 第2章 管理 REST API Red Hat build of Keycloak には、管理コンソールの全機能が含まれる、完全に機能する管理 REST API が同梱されています。 API を呼び出すには、適切な権限を持つアクセス Chapter 2. Keycloak 配备了功能齐全的管理 REST API,它提供了管理控制台的所有功能。 要调用 API,您需要获得具有适当权限的访问令牌。 所需的权限在 服务器管理指南 中进行了描述。 Keycloak is based on a set of administrative UIs and a RESTful API, and provides the necessary means to create permissions for your protected It is not recommended to use it directly from your applications. See examples using CURL and Java client library. For logout users, it is recommended to use either OIDC/SAML protocol standard logout or Keycloak Admin console (or other way of admin The Keycloak admin client is a Java library that facilitates the access and usage of the Keycloak Admin REST API. Browse the resources, definitions, and examples for each endpoint and Open Source Identity and Access Management For Modern Applications and Services - keycloak/docs/documentation/api_documentation at main · keycloak/keycloak Keycloak API Quick Reference: Comprehensive, developer-friendly documentation that covers all CRUD of a user lifecycle. To invoke the API you need to obtain an access Conclusion In this article, we explored how to integrate Keycloak’s REST API into your C# application using a generated API client from the OpenAPI spec. JitPack makes it easy to release your Java or Android library. 12. JavaDocs Documentation 1. Thousands of developers learned the basics of building a REST API using Spring Boot from the InfoQ minibook, "Practical Guide to Building an API Other Keycloak Projects Keycloak - Keycloak Server and Java adapters Keycloak Documentation - Documentation for Keycloak Keycloak QuickStarts - QuickStarts for getting started with Keycloak Overview This is a REST API reference for the Keycloak Admin REST API. REST 管理 API | サーバー開発者ガイド | Red Hat build of Keycloak | 22. Admin REST API Keycloak comes with a fully functional Admin REST API with all features provided by the Admin Console. Learn how to programmatically manage realms, users, roles, and clients for automation and integration. Red Hat build of Keycloak API Documentation Making open source more inclusive 1. 0 (the "License"); you may not use this file except in compliance with the Chapter 2. Comprehensive API documentation for Keycloak, including JavaDocs and Admin REST API references. Feature flags Default Using quarkus-oidc-client, quarkus-rest-client-oidc-filter and quarkus-resteasy-client-oidc-filter extensions to acquire and refresh access tokens from OpenID REST Management API You can create, remove, and update your user storage provider deployments through the administrator REST API. Export events to your stack and trigger workflows on identity changes. This is particularly useful for tasks such as: Bulk User Creation Chapter 2. Learn how to use the Keycloak Admin REST API to manage realms, clients, users, authentication, authorization, and more. If you are using Java, you can access the Keycloak 管理REST API Keycloakには、管理コンソールが提供するすべての機能を完全に備えた管理REST APIが付属しています。 APIを呼び出すには、適切な権限を持つアクセストークンを取得する必要 Complete guide to integrating Django REST Framework with Keycloak using mozilla-django-oidc. 0 | Red Hat Documentation AI learning hub Explore learning materials and tools, organized by task. 2 | Red Hat Documentation The following example assumes that you created the user admin with the password The Keycloak REST API Guideline provides a set of design principles and practices that should be considered by developers when designing, implementing and The Keycloak REST API Guideline provides a set of design principles and practices that should be considered by developers when designing, implementing and exposing a RESTful API. 2. 4. org. Features Implements Keycloak Admin REST API version 26. keycloak. API Documentation | Red Hat build of Keycloak | 22. Admin REST API {project_name} comes with a fully functional Admin REST API with all features provided by the Admin Console. All invitations are now persistently stored in the database, providing better tracking and management capabilities. authenticators. Chapter 2. API Documentation | Red Hat build of Keycloak | 26. Red Hat build of Keycloak API Documentation Red Hat build of Keycloak API Documentation 1. Step-by-step guide with code snippets. Learn how to use the Admin REST API to manage Keycloak realms, users, clients, and more. Admin REST API REST API Architecture Relevant source files Purpose and Scope This document describes Keycloak's REST API architecture, focusing on the structural organization of Admin REST 最終更新日 2025-04-11 12:43:59 UTC Chapter 2. The library requires Java 11 or higher at runtime (RESTEasy dependency enforces this The Keycloak Admin Console is implemented entirely with a fully functional REST admin API. This is where the Keycloak REST API shines. Keycloak Documenation related to the most recent Keycloak release. NET Core client library for Keycloak that simplifies integration with Keycloak's authentication and authorization services. Open source Keycloak extension that adds first-class organizations: per-tenant SSO, invitations, roles, and APIs. Examples of using CURL Authenticating 第 2 章 Admin REST API 红帽构建的 Keycloak 附带了一个功能齐全的 Admin REST API,以及管理控制台提供的所有功能。 若要调用 API,您需要获取具有适当权限的访问令牌。 服务器管理指南 中描述 Keycloak-client is a set of Java libraries, which can be used in the client applications to invoke Keycloak server public APIs. 1. authenticators org. For Open source Keycloak extension that adds webhooks, event scripts, and an audit log REST API on top of the Keycloak event SPI. The invitation management features are available in the Invitations tab Description The client scope representation in the REST API documentation does not include the 'type', which prevents us from setting this using the REST API, defeating its purpose. Related Issues: . access org. Red Hat, as the licensor of this document, waives the right to enforce, and agrees not to assert, Section 4d of CC-BY-SA to the fullest extent permitted by applicable law. To invoke the API you need to obtain an access token with the Register a cluster node with the client Manually register cluster node to this client - usually it’s not needed to call this directly as adapter should handle by sending registration request to Keycloak JavaDocs Documentation JavaDocs Documentation Admin REST API Documentation Administration REST API I am using Keycloak 26 on Docker (locally) and the health check does not work. Client roles ensure authorized 7. To invoke the API you need to obtain an access Atlassian - JIRA on the Postman API Network: This public workspace features ready-to-use APIs, Collections, and more from API Evangelist. According to documentation, I added this configuration for it: - Step-by-step with Keycloak Admin API versions from 15. This include Keycloak admin Keycloak Admin REST API Keycloak Admin REST API Legal Dual-licensed under MIT or the UNLICENSE. Red Hat build of Keycloak comes with a fully functional Admin REST API with all features provided by the Admin Console. refgn, wnvg, q7sq, sgxs, 2sz, c5h8x, h0zx, ofeo, d7l, qq, rm8ff, mswo82, ujrav, qinrm9, nuu9lm, ve1u, kci, r80n, yuifgzo, tliyl5, nece, 0roq, rzx, 0hs, 2ewp, ic7l, oecpl, gryb, os3vd, oub, \